Toronto Assertiveness Training Workshop

Many job-related frustrations and stresses can be traced to discomfort in handling the following types of situations:

  • Making difficult and unpopular requests of others
  • Responding to unreasonable demands of others
  • Saying no
  • Disagreeing with someone’s ideas

We may avoid dealing with these types of situations or may offend others by coming on too strong.

Our Toronto based assertiveness training workshop will enable participants to act assertively by expressing feelings or thoughts directly and firmly with composure.

Objectives

  • To learn the assertiveness skills essential to getting your ideas, plans and feelings across with confidence and conviction
  • To differentiate between aggressive behaviors which can create antagonism, assertive behavior and passive behaviors, which can hinder your performance
  • To overcome any reluctance and to practice assertiveness appropriately in dealing with difficult situations
  • To improve interpersonal relationships, job satisfaction and task accomplishment
